Understanding the Nature of Addiction

Addiction is not merely a physical dependence on substances like drugs or alcohol; it’s a complex interplay of psychological, social, and behavioural factors. Substance abuse disorders often stem from deeper emotional and psychological issues. Substance abuse disorders frequently arise from deeper emotional or psychological challenges relating to unresolved trauma, stress, depression anxiety and other mental health challenges; therefore treating addiction requires taking into account these underlying issues as well as its physical manifestation.

Counselling Drug Addicts: More Than Just Therapy

Counselling for drug addiction is more than simply talking; it is an active therapeutic process aimed at untangling all the factors contributing to addiction, in a safe, non-judgmental space where individuals can explore their emotions, behaviours and thoughts freely without judgment from professionals. Skilled counsellors use various techniques to assist their clients in uncovering the root causes of their addiction as well as understand triggers while developing coping mechanisms to alleviate cravings and prevent relapse.

Alcohol Addiction Counselling: A Path to Self-Discovery

Alcohol addiction counselling is particularly crucial, given the social acceptance of alcohol and its pervasive presence in many societies. Counselling helps individuals understand their relationship with alcohol, identify patterns of harmful drinking, and work toward creating healthier interactions between substances and users. Counselling also empowers people with knowledge to make more informed choices regarding their alcohol consumption.

The Benefits of Addiction Counselling

  1. Developing Coping Mechanisms: Counselling equips individuals with the tools to manage the stressors and triggers that lead to substance abuse. This includes strategies for coping with cravings, dealing with negative emotions, and avoiding situations that might lead to relapse.
  2. Improving Mental Health: Addiction often co-occurs with mental health disorders. Counselling addresses these co-occurring disorders, providing a holistic approach to treatment that improves overall mental health and well-being.
  3. Enhancing Self-Esteem and Self-Worth: Through counselling, individuals gain insights into their worth beyond their addiction. This can lead to improved self-esteem and a stronger sense of self, which are crucial for long-term recovery.
  4. Repairing Relationships: Addiction counselling also focuses on helping individuals repair and rebuild relationships damaged by their substance abuse. This might involve family therapy or learning new communication and interpersonal skills.
  5. Preventing Relapse: One of the primary goals of counselling is to prevent relapse. By understanding the root causes of addiction and developing effective coping strategies, individuals are better equipped to maintain long-term sobriety.
